Main job tasks:
Perform medical writing tasks:
• Clinical trial reports (CTRs)
• Lay summaries of clinical trial results
• Clinical evaluation plans (CEP) and Clinical evaluation reports (CER)
• Investigator brochures (IBs)
• Paediatric investigational plans (PIPs)
• Clinical summary and overview documents in CTD/eCTD format for regulatory submissions world-wide (including investigational medicinal product dossiers (IMPDs), investigational new drug applications (INDs), marketing authorisation applications (MAAs), new drug applications (NDAs), variations and supplemental new drug applications (sNDAs))
• Replies to questions from authorities
• Deliverables (briefing book, slides) for Advisory Committee Meetings
• Publications (abstracts, posters and slide presentations for conferences and other scientific meetings, and manuscripts for scientific journals)
• Protocol, protocol outlines and SI/IC
• Other ad-hoc documents (e.g. meeting packages)

You are:
- ≥5 years experience as Medical Writer or equivalent
- Pharmaceutical industry understanding
- Excellent understanding of clinical development and regulatory processes and requirements
- Business and R&D value chain understanding
- Excellent communication and presentation skills
- Experience with a broad range of different medical writing tasks
- Good mentoring and training skills
- Demonstrated ability to identify better practice and create improvements in methods, techniques, approaches etc
Established record of being a proactive team-player and able to deliver on time and with high quality.
